Understanding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ction, often referred to as compulsive gambling, is a condition that can severely impact a person’s life. It is characterized by an uncontrollable urge to gamble, despite the negative consequences that may arise. This addiction can lead to financial difficulties, strained relationships, and emotional distress, making it crucial to recognize the early signs to seek help promptly. Unlike casual gambling, which can be a harmless pastime, gambling addiction is marked by a loss of control. Individuals may find themselves betting more than they can afford or lying about their gambling habits. Understanding these nuances is vital in identifying when a gambling habit has escalated to addiction.

Signs of Gambling Addiction

One of the primary signs of gambling addiction is the preoccupation with gambling. Individuals may constantly think about past gambling experiences or plan their next gambling activity. This fixation can overshadow other important aspects of life, such as work, family, and personal interests.

Another common indicator is chasing losses. Many individuals with gambling addiction will continue to gamble in an attempt to recover lost money, leading to a harmful cycle of loss and desperation. This behavior not only exacerbates financial problems but also intensifies emotional stress, as the individual becomes trapped in a cycle that is increasingly difficult to escape.

The Emotional Toll of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ction does not only have financial implications; it significantly affects emotional well-being. Individuals may experience feelings of guilt, anxiety, and depression related to their gambling habits. The emotional highs associated with winning can lead to intense lows, which may result in mood swings and irritability when losses occur.

Moreover, relationships often suffer as a result of gambling addiction. Loved ones may feel neglected or betrayed, especially if trust is broken due to lying about gambling activities. This emotional strain can lead to isolation, further complicating the individual’s situation and making it harder to seek help.

Steps to Take if You Recognize the Signs

Recognizing the signs of gambling addiction is the first crucial step toward recovery. If you or someone you know exhibits these behaviors, it is essential to take action. The initial step often involves an open and honest conversation about the issue. Encouraging a supportive environment can significantly aid the individual in acknowledging their problem and seeking help.

Professional treatment options, including therapy and support groups, can provide the necessary resources for recovery. Many individuals benefit from counseling that addresses not only the gambling addiction but also underlying issues such as anxiety or depression. Early intervention can lead to more effective recovery outcomes.
